ST. PETERSBURG, Fla.–PSCU has officially cut the ribbon on its new Member Experience Center here, which it said has been purposefully designed for cross-disciplinary collaboration and innovation.
The Center includes an array of interactive kiosks designed to illustrate how PSCU works together with credit unions to achieve collective success, according to PSCU. It also includes meeting space.
“The Member Experience Center offers PSCU and credit unions a chance to walk in the footsteps of the member,” said PSCU President Chuck Fagan just prior to cutting the ribbon.
When entering the Member Experience Center visitors are greeted by an eight-foot wide interactive touch screen touting an immersive hands-on approach, which serves as a starting point for a series of interactive experiences. Beyond the welcome wall are a collection of interactive kiosks, touch screens, augmented reality experiences and digital white boards to showcase and illustrate how PSCU works to support, protect and optimize every transaction and interaction for credit union members, the company said.
“This facility is dedicated to collaboration,” said Lynn Heckler, PSCU’s chief talent officer during the opening ceremony. “What we are creating is a culture for collaboration.”
By bringing people together, Heckler said, it contributes to the kind of diversity of thought necessary to develop the types of product and service solutions credit unions need to meet the needs of members.
A half-dozen or so credit unions have actively participated in a focus group to provide ideas, guidance and feedback through every phase of the project.
